Manor F1 could delay new car plans until 2016

Manor F1 team is reportedly contemplating shelving its plans to introduce a new car in 2015. Earlier, having hurriedly modified the 2014 machine for the 2015 rule changes, the former Marussia outfit announced its intention to debut an all-new car after the summer break. But Speed Week now reports that, as the current car is comfortably qualifying within 107 per cent, the team is wondering whether it should instead turn its focus towards the 2016 season. The news follows Manor having signed up some new and experienced faces, including the former Renault and Mercedes chief Bob Bell as advisor. Team president Graeme Lowdon admitted that Bell has put his immediate focus on 'the big picture'....
